How much does it cost to rent an apartment in La Vista?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| La Vista Studio Apartments | $1,080 | $711 | $1,340 |
| La Vista 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,230 | $650 | $2,294 |
| La Vista 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,485 | $930 | $2,881 |
| La Vista 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,916 | $1,155 | $3,477 |
| La Vista 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,190 | $1,540 | $3,295 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om La Vista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in La Vista with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in La Vista is at Lakeview Apartments listed at $930.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om La Vista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in La Vista is $1,485.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om La Vista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in La Vista is a 2,065 square feet unit starting from $2,395 at Bungalows on the Lake at Prairie Queen.
What is the average size for La Vista 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in La Vista is currently 1,440 sq ft.
